The cheapest way to get from York to Rushden is to bus via Leeds which costs £16 - £26 and takes 6h 42m.
The fastest way to get from York to Rushden is to drive which takes 2h 32m and costs £35 - £55.
No, there is no direct bus from York station to Rushden. However, there are services departing from Rail Station and arriving at (Rushden) Skinners Hill Layby via Milton Keynes Coachway and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 3m.
The distance between York and Rushden is 172 miles. The road distance is 141.5 miles.
The best way to get from York to Rushden without a car is to train which takes 4h 44m and costs £65 - £100.
It takes approximately 4h 44m to get from York to Rushden, including transfers.
York to Rushden b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Rail Station.
The best way to get from York to Rushden is to train which takes 4h 44m and costs £65 - £100.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£30 - £85 and takes 6h 3m.
York to Rushden bus services, operated by National Express, arrive at Milton Keynes Coachway station.
Yes, the driving distance between York to Rushden is 141 miles. It takes approximately 2h 32m to drive from York to Rushden.
